As an M365 Consultant, you will use your Microsoft 365 expertise to focus on information protection, data security, and compliance. Working within a delivery team, you will help clients implement secure Microsoft 365 environments and safeguard their data. You’ll support organisations in governing data across collaboration platforms, analytics environments, and emerging AI use cases. This role is ideal for those passionate about helping clients address evolving security and compliance challenges in the digital age.
Responsibilities:
- Implement and configure Microsoft Purview solutions, including sensitivity labels, encryption, DLP, retention labels, and records management across Exchange, SharePoint, OneDrive, and Teams.
- Support data discovery, classification, and protection initiatives to enhance information security and compliance.
- Assist in the deployment and configuration of Microsoft Defender for Office 365, enabling Safe Links, Safe Attachments, anti‑phishing, and anti‑malware policies.
- Configure Microsoft Defender for Cloud Apps to monitor and control data sharing, manage session controls, and identify risky user or data activities.
- Maintain awareness of endpoint risk and integrate Microsoft Defender for Endpoint with Conditional Access and Zero Trust strategies.
- Gain exposure to or support advanced data protection scenarios, such as Insider Risk Management, Communication Compliance, eDiscovery, and regulatory compliance.
- Configure and secure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, OneDrive, and Teams, and support identity and access management using Microsoft Entra ID.
- Contribute to data governance initiatives across analytics platforms, supporting data discovery, classification, and protection in environments like Microsoft Fabric and Data Lake.
- Collaborate with client IT and security teams, support workshops and technical discussions, and communicate configuration decisions, risks, and recommendations effectively.
About the Candidate:
- Holds a 2:1 degree in Computer Science or a related field, with relevant certifications such as SC‑900, SC‑400, MS‑900, or MS‑102.
- 2–5 years of experience working with Microsoft 365 environments.
- Hands‑on expertise with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, Teams administration, and Microsoft Entra ID fundamentals.
- Practical experience implementing Microsoft Purview Information Protection, DLP, retention, or compliance policies.
- Proven track record of delivering projects or platform changes, beyond routine operational support.
- Exposure to Insider Risk management, eDiscovery, or Defender for Office 365 is advantageous.
- Experience with Defender for Cloud Apps, including data visibility, sharing controls, or policy configuration, is desirable.
- Understanding how Defender integrates with Purview, Entra ID, and Conditional Access is beneficial.
- Experience leading workshops or acting as a subject matter expert and working in a client‑facing or consulting environment is a plus.
